That looks like the starter off of a Detroit Diesel two stroke diesel. There are a lot of them still running so if it works, somebody could likely use it. The motor looks pretty old which makes me think it may have come off of a 71 series engine. They were in production 1938-1995 so electronics came a long way over the run of that engine.

That is a Delco 35MT. The number you posted is for the drive end housing. That housing is specific to 3 different 35MT starters: 1113601, 1113607 and 1109227. There is no specifics on what they fit, only industrial applications. My guess is that they are all the same starter in 12v, 24v and 32v.
